It isn't common for players to make the NHL right out of their draft year. Out of the Flames' current kids, Sean Monahan was the only one to achieve that feat. The rest of their current core took longer to reach where they now are.
This isn't a bad thing, though. Typically, only a handful of players actually make the NHL right after they're drafted. The first overall picks always do, plus a handful of others - almost always only guys chosen in the top 10.
Does Matthew Tkachuk have what it takes? Maybe - let's take a look at what players who made the NHL immediately this decade have in common.
